Philosophy — 5 rules to remember

  1. Power is a relationship, not a position. An alpha who can't maintain support is soon deposed. Authority is granted by the group, not seized.
  2. Coalitions determine outcomes. No individual, no matter how powerful, can rule alone. Alliances shift. Yesterday's ally may be today's rival.
  3. Reconciliation is as important as conflict. The strongest groups are not those without conflict but those that repair after conflict. Chimp reconciliation rituals are sophisticated.
  4. Leadership requires both strength and generosity. Effective alphas protect the weak, share resources, and maintain peace. Pure aggression creates instability.
  5. Social intelligence is the most adaptive skill. Reading the room, understanding relationships, predicting behavior — this is what matters for success in any social group.

Core Framework Quick Reference

  • Alpha Male / Female = Not just the strongest but the one who maintains the most stable coalitions. True alpha status is political, not physical.
  • Coalition = A temporary or permanent alliance. The fundamental unit of power. No one rules alone.
  • Reconciliation = Post-conflict behavior that repairs relationships. Chimpanzees reconcile with embraces, grooming, and appeasement gestures. Groups that reconcile well are more stable.
  • Power Takeover = A shift in alpha status. Usually involves coalition-building followed by a confrontation. Rarely a surprise to observant group members.
  • Social Ladder = The hierarchy within a group. It's not fixed — it shifts with alliances, conflicts, and changes in individual standing.
  • Arbitration Role = The alpha's role in mediating conflict. An alpha who doesn't keep peace loses legitimacy.

Key Principles

  1. Watch the coalitions, not just the leader. The person with the most formal power may not have the most real influence.
  2. Power takes work to maintain. An alpha who stops tending coalitions will be challenged.
  3. Reconciliation is strategic. The group that repairs quickly after conflict outperforms the group that avoids conflict.
  4. Status is multidimensional. Not everyone wants to be alpha. Some thrive in beta, gamma, or specialist roles.
  5. Conflict is not failure — it's information. How a group handles conflict tells you everything about its health.

Anti-Pattern Summary

The book's core correction: Most people assume power comes from position or strength. The chimp lesson is that power comes from relationships, coalitions, and maintaining group cohesion. Confusing hierarchy with authority is the fundamental mistake. See references/4-anti-patterns.md.
